Where is California?

California is the most heavily populated state in the U.S., with nearly 40 million residents. It is also the third largest state in terms of size, behind Alaska and Texas.

California is on the west coast of the United States, with 840 miles of coastline on the Pacific Ocean. California’s size means that the state’s climate varies greatly from one region to another. As such, there is never a bad time to visit California. Southern California’s warm weather and sunny beaches make it a great destination in summer and winter alike. Northern California is also very popular in the summer.

Los Angeles International Airport (LAX) is the largest airport in the state. But there are dozens of other large airports in the state that can accommodate both commercial and private flights. Other major airports in the state include San Diego International Airport, San Francisco International Airport, and Fresno Yosemite International Airport.

Popular California Attractions and Activities

California is filled with famous landmarks and must-see destinations. Perhaps the most enduring image associated with the state is the Golden Gate Bridge in San Francisco.

To capitalize on the abundance of destinations, many travelers rely on California vacation packages to see as much as they can. For families traveling to the state, Disneyland Resort and its theme parks are often an essential part of any package. Other major destinations include Lake Tahoe in Central California, on the state’s border with Nevada.

A short drive south from Tahoe is spectacular Yosemite National Park. Yosemite is home to some of North America’s most captivating natural sites and hiking trails. The park’s natural splendor makes it a great destination for both family trips and larger outdoor excursions.

California has more destinations and attractions than can possibly be listed here. Beyond the main attractions, resort towns like Palm Springs offer unmatched vacation amenities.

The state is also home to some of the most varied natural landscapes you can find anywhere in the U.S. From the vast deserts of Death Valley National Park, to the lush and magnificent forests of Redwood National and State Forests, there is no end to California’s natural beauty.
